## Changelog — Font vendoring defaults changed

As of this release, the Bracken UI build no longer fetches third-party fonts at build time. All typefaces used by the Lanternwell suite are now vendored into the repo under a dedicated assets directory, and the fetch step is skipped by default. If you're onboarding, nothing to install — the fonts travel with the checkout. The build flags controlling this behavior are listed below.

settings of hadup-yafog:
LAMAEL_PIN=3761
LAMAEL_TENANT=istmir
LAMAEL_METRICS_HOST=metrics.lamael.plorvasys.test
LAMAEL_SEAL=seal_8ea68500
LAMAEL_STANDBY_TEAM=fraok

### Step 6: Health checks

After cutting traffic to the new Harrowgate pool, update the Vextra load balancer health checks to target the new readiness endpoint, which verifies both cache and queue connectivity. Keep intervals conservative during migration to avoid flapping. Apply the health-check configuration shown below.

config for kawif-hahig:
zorix:
  log_level: error
  metrics_host: metrics.zorix.lumiclabs.internal
  pool_size: 16

Subject: Handover — Stridepath chip reader ingest

Hi Meron,

For your review: the timing-chip reader posts split times in batches of 200, deduplicated on chip serial plus gate timestamp. I changed the retry logic to idempotent upserts, so duplicate batches are now harmless. Please verify the unique index before approving. The test fixtures load against the database reachable via the string below.

replica DSN, yahog-kawig: redis://istox_svc:um@db-8a67.halixforge.test:5432/frawyn

## Improve encoding detection for text uploads

This change replaces the naive BOM check in Inkwell's upload pipeline with a confidence-scored detector that samples the file head, falls back to a secondary pass on the full body when ambiguous, and records the decision in the ingest log for later triage. On-call: if detection misfires, the `inkwell.encoding.fallback` metric spikes before user reports arrive. Detection behavior is governed by the constants below.

tuning constants:
QUOTAS = {
    "druwyn": 5,
    "holix": 5,
    "zorath": 5,
    "holwyn": 10,
}